1. GRAPE: It protects from heart and circulation diseases.

Benefits: Consumed a lot in summer, grapes are rich in sugar. In addition, anthocyanins and flavonoids in its content increase its antioxidant properties. It helps prevent blood clotting and the oxidizing effect of LDL cholesterol, known as bad cholesterol. In this way, it also prevents heart and blood circulation diseases. Grapes contain a high amount of water and fiber. This also helps to cleanse the liver and intestines. Especially since black grape contains quercetin, which helps to prevent inflammation, it provides the heart and circulation system to work systematically and supports the digestive system. Grapes are a powerful antioxidant source, with a carbohydrate measure of 18.1 grams in a bunch of about 100 grams, 0.7 grams of protein and 0.9 grams of fiber. Thanks to the resveratrol in the grape, which should be consumed very carefully by diabetic individuals due to its strong carbohydrate content, it provides a protective effect against cancer. In addition, quarcetin provides support for the circulation and digestive system, and has a preventive effect on constipation problems in individuals.

Measure: Since the sugar content is high, it is necessary not to exaggerate the size too much and to end the portion with 15 fresh grapes.

2.APRICOT: It helps to weaken.

Benefits: One of the most indispensable fruits of the summer months is apricot. The amount of fiber it contains makes apricots take place in the middle of indispensable fruits in diets. With its high carotenoid content, apricot acts as an elixir of youth. It supports the immune system and protects the skin. It also contains lycopene, one of the strongest antioxidants. Lycopene also prevents the accumulation of fat in the veins. Apricot, which contains 11.12 grams of carbohydrates, 1.4 grams of protein and 2 grams of fiber in 100 grams, is one of the indispensable summer fruits. Apricots, whose 100 grams are approximately 48 calories, replace 1 portion of fruit when 3-4 pieces are consumed. It is a very strong fruit in terms of potassium, iron and magnesium, as well as being strong in terms of vitamins A and C. Due to its composition, it has been proven by scientific studies that it has a constipation-defying feature, as well as a protective effect against lung and stomach cancer. Thanks to its potassium content, it is valuable in regulating blood pressure.

Size: Consuming 4 fresh apricots a day is enough for the body.

3. BLUEBERRY: It rejuvenates the skin.

Benefits: One of the foods that has excited the scientific world lately is blueberry. It contains some aspects that help keep the brain young and is rich in anthocyanins. Blueberries also contain a powerful antioxidant that accelerates blood circulation and protects against aging. Anthocyanin increases the effect of vitamin C, supports collagen and beautifies the skin. Blueberry, which is a valuable source of pectin, reduces the cholesterol rate thanks to this feature.

Size: You can consume 2-3 tablespoons of blueberries a day.

4. BLACKBERRY: It fights infections.

Benefits: Blackberry, which is a great source of vitamin C, also contains vitamin E. It helps to eliminate the effect of free radicals that cause premature aging of the skin and heart diseases. Blackberry is the natural source of salicylate, the active ingredient in aspirin, which fights body infections.

Measure: You can provide yourself these benefits by eating half a glass of blackberries a day.

6.Watermelon: It helps to lose weight.

Benefits: Watermelon, which contains plenty of water and vitamin C, facilitates digestion and helps the intestines work. Watermelon, which contains plenty of lycopene, has a cancer-preventing effect. It regulates heart functions and blood pressure. It has the lowest strength in the middle of all fruits. There are 26 calories in 100 grams. Watermelon, which is indispensable for summer fruits containing 95 percent water, has 7.5 grams of carbohydrates, 0.6 grams of protein and 0.4 grams of fiber. Since most of its calories come from carbohydrates, we should prefer it with a protein source such as cheese, in order not to disturb the control of blood sugar. Thanks to its cooling effect, watermelon is the savior of menopausal women and pregnant women. It is very easy to digest because of its high water content and low fiber content. It provides the basis for the kidneys to work effectively.

Size: It can be consumed with peace of mind if the size is not exaggerated in weight loss diets.

7. CHERRY: It relaxes the joints, strengthens the eyes.

Benefits: Cherry, which is a fruit enjoyed by everyone in summer, contains plenty of vitamin C. It is a fruit rich in flavonoids such as anthocyanins that support the body’s immunity. It also contains quercetin, a powerful anti-inflammatory element that relieves joint pain and defends against eye diseases. It is also a powerful food in terms of plant-derived chemical ellagic acid, which has anti-carcinogenic properties. In addition, it helps to fight viruses and bacteria with its vitamin cherry. Cherries, 100 grams of which contain 65 calories, 22.9 grams of carbohydrates, 1 gram of protein, and 2.1 grams of fiber, are the saviors of individuals with constipation problems. It is quite effective in regulating blood pressure, moreover, it functions as a diuretic. While it provides reinforcement for the elimination of edema in the body, it has a protective effect against cardiovascular diseases. Thanks to the active element of melatonin, it relaxes the body and provides a comfortable sleep system. It helps to remove uric acid and urate crystals from the body.

Size: You can eat up to 12 cherries a day with peace of mind.

8. STRAWBERRY: It makes us feel happy.

Benefits: Strawberry, the first fruit that comes to mind when it comes to red, is valuable for collagen production. It is a complete source of vitamin C. Vitamin C also plays a valuable role in healing wounds. It prevents gum diseases. It contains ellagic acid, which has very strong anti-carcinogenic properties. Strawberry, which is one of the fruits most suitable for psychology, prevents constipation with its abundant fiber content. It contains about 5.5 grams of carbohydrates, 0.8 grams of protein and 2 grams of fiber per 100 grams. Strawberry, which is a very strong fruit in terms of vitamin C, helps our immune system to be strong. Thanks to its fiber content and being a juicy fruit, it has the effect of relieving constipation. Thanks to its high potassium content, it also helps to balance our blood pressure.

Size: 10 strawberries a day are enough for your health.

10. PEACH: Strengthens immunity.

Benefits: One of the most preferred fruits in summer is peach. However, while overeating causes constipation, the ingredients in it renew the body and strengthen immunity. It facilitates digestion and is a useful fruit for the kidneys. 1 serving of peach, which has 9.54 grams of carbohydrates, 0.9 grams of protein and 1.5 grams of fiber in its structure, is about a medium size and is about 47 calories. It is much healthier to consume peach, which is a fruit with strong fiber content, with its peel. It is a very ideal fruit for balancing blood pressure on hot summer days. Peach, which is also a strong fruit in terms of vitamin C, is also a very useful fruit for strengthening our immune system.

Size: It is enough to eat 1 peach a day.
